 Chesapeake Bay Girl Scouts & League of Women Voters

to Host Promise of Democracy Event 

 

Girl Scouts of the Chesapeake Bay is excited to announce a our inaugural Founder's Day Feature Event, "The Promise of Democracy: Empowering our World Together," taking place on Saturday, October 26, 2024, from 9 AM to 3 PM at Clayton Hall, located at 100 David Hollowell Dr. Newark, DE 19716. This event is in partnership with the League of Women Voters and is made possible by donations from M&T Bank, Delmarva Power, Inc., and other generous sponsors.

This inspiring event will bring together Girl Scouts from across the region, local elected officials, and community leaders to celebrate civic engagement and empower today's girls to make their voices heard.

The event will feature a panel discussion with local officials, including State Representative Sherry Dorsey Walker, military veteran and community advocate Debbie Harrington, and more. These leaders will share their experiences in public service, discuss the importance of civic participation, and answer questions from Girl Scouts and attendees.

In addition to the panel, the event will include keynote speakers and hands-on activities designed by the League of Women Voters to educate Girl Scouts about the democratic process, local, state and national government, and leveraging their leadership skills to make an impact. Girl Scouts will engage in activities that foster teamwork, critical thinking, and confidence, preparing them to be the leaders of tomorrow and earning them their Democracy badge!

Empowering Girl Scouts to understand and participate in democracy is a vital part of their Girl Scout experience, said Claudia Pena Porretti, Chief Executive Officer of Girl Scouts of the Chesapeake Bay. This event not only allows them to learn from our elected officials but also encourages them to envision themselves as future leaders in their communities.

"The Promise of Democracy: Empowering our World Together" event is open to all current and prospective Girl Scouts (grades K-12). Lunch will be provided, and activities will cater to all Girl Scout program levels.
